Heat flux is the flow of heat energy. Also called thermal flux, heat flux occurs by conduction and convection in the direction of...
Heat flux or thermal flux is the rate of heat energy transfer through a given surface, per unit surface. The SI derived unit of heat rate is joule per second, or watt.
